Hryhoriy Baran studied the work of an international relations office at a US university. He focused his research on the experience of the US universities in the sphere of working with international students as well as study abroad programs for American students. He is interested in all aspects of work with foreign students, including policies and legal issues (admission requirements and evaluation of academic credentials, visa procedures); recruitment and retention (marketing of programs, partnerships with foreign universities and organizations); academic and student services (orientation programs, language training and guidebooks for international students). Upon his return he plans to develop programs like a university strategic plan focused on the attraction of international students; university policies, regulations and mechanisms necessary for work with international students; a recruitment program; an orientation program, guidelines and services for helping international students to adjust and become successful.
